In Jaipur, Man Structurals Pvt. Ltd. marked National Energy Conservation Day by announcing significant strides in sustainable operations. Nearly 30% of its energy now comes from solar installations, producing about 8 lakh kWh annually. This move is part of the company's commitment to reducing its reliance on the grid and supporting national conservation efforts.

The shift is instrumental in decreasing CO₂ emissions by 656–680 metric tons annually, mirroring the absorption capability of over 30,000 trees. Managing Director Gaurav Rungta emphasized that for such a heavy industry player, sustainability is paramount, aligning with national energy and low-carbon economy goals.

Beyond solar energy, Man Structurals integrates environmentally friendly practices, reducing waste and preserving water, further fortifying their dedication to eco-conscious industrial development. Initiatives like the National Solar Mission are pivotal, as the company envisages deriving 50% of its energy from renewable sources by 2030.
